Abstract

Stable isotopic samples were analyzed from rain, snow, springs, irrigation wells, and two deep geothermal wells. The stable isotopic analysis indicate that meteoric water from the mountains surrounding Dixie Valley continually recharges the geothermal reservoir by fracture flow.
